%description
GNU MP is a library for arbitrary precision arithmetic, operating
on signed integers, rational numbers, and floating point numbers.
It has a rich set of functions, and the functions have a regular
interface. GNU MP is designed to be as fast as possible, both for
small operands and for huge operands. The speed is achieved by using
fullwords as the basic arithmetic type, by using fast algorithms, by
carefully optimized assembly code for the most common inner loops
for a lot of CPUs, and by a general emphasis on speed (instead of
simplicity or elegance).
